## Top Story

The Senate’s procedural vote on the Digital Asset Market Clarity Act is the market’s main event on September 15. Cloture is scheduled for **2:15 p.m. ET** and requires **60 votes**. It would begin floor consideration, not pass the bill.

Revised legislation includes ethics provisions, state attorneys general enforcement authority, and changes to federal oversight. Crypto traders are focused on SEC and CFTC jurisdiction, DeFi language, stablecoins, and restrictions involving government officials and their families.

The market reaction was cautious. [Bitcoin](https://coinstats.app/coins/bitcoin) traded near $77,263, down 0.57%, while [Ethereum](https://coinstats.app/coins/ethereum) fell 1.37%. Social sentiment described the vote as important but assigned limited conviction to final passage because of the narrow voting margin and unresolved negotiations.

The next catalyst is the vote itself, followed by the Federal Reserve decision on **September 16**. A successful cloture vote could improve regulatory sentiment, while failure would likely preserve uncertainty around U.S. digital-asset market structure.

### Bitcoin ETF Outflows Contrast With Ether ETF Demand

U.S. spot [Bitcoin](https://coinstats.app/coins/bitcoin) ETFs recorded approximately **$462.7 million** in net outflows from September 8 through September 11. The period included a **$282.7 million** single-day outflow on Thursday.

Spot [Ethereum](https://coinstats.app/coins/ethereum) ETFs recorded approximately **$196.9 million** in net inflows during the same period. Separate September 14 data showed Bitcoin ETF outflows of **$72.67 million** and Ethereum ETF inflows of **$186.65 million**. These periods should not be combined.

The flow split matches the price action. Bitcoin weakened despite its larger market structure, while Ethereum remained under pressure even as its ETF products attracted stronger recent inflows.

### CoinEx Announces an Orderly Wind-Down

Hong Kong-based CoinEx announced that it will cease operations after citing weaker market conditions, lower trading volumes and liquidity, and rising compliance costs.

New registrations and several account services stopped on September 15. Non-spot services are scheduled to end on **September 22**, spot trading on **September 29**, and withdrawals on **December 22, 2026**. CoinEx also said its reserve ratio exceeds 100%.

The exchange said CoinEx Smart Chain and OneSwap will shut down on September 29. Remaining CET balances will be repurchased at **0.005 USDT per CET**. X discussion was limited and did not produce a broad panic narrative, but users should treat the published withdrawal deadline as operationally important.

### Symbiosis Bridge Exploit

Cross-chain protocol Symbiosis reported that an attacker minted approximately **46.1 billion unbacked syBTC** on BNB Chain through its BridgeV2. About **4.39 WBTC** was sold on Uniswap, generating roughly **$336,000**.

Symbiosis said the Bitcoin Bridge was halted and isolated. Approximately **15 BTC** was recovered and placed in a team-controlled multisignature wallet. The protocol offered a **20% white-hat bounty**.

The incident highlights continuing bridge and oracle risks. A separate report said SpiralCom lost approximately **10.7 ETH** through collateral valuation based on a Uniswap V4 spot price. Neither incident produced evidence of a broad market contagion event.

## Derivatives and Positioning

Derivatives data showed a bullish but not heavily crowded market.

| Asset | Open Interest | 24h Change | Current Funding | 24h Liquidations |
|---|---:|---:|---:|---:|
| [BTC](https://coinstats.app/coins/bitcoin) | $51.78B | -$862.89M, -1.64% | 0.0031% per 8h | $48.58M |
| [ETH](https://coinstats.app/coins/ethereum) | $32.60B | +$114.57M, +0.35% | 0.0040% per 8h | $87.26M |

Combined [Bitcoin](https://coinstats.app/coins/bitcoin) and [Ethereum](https://coinstats.app/coins/ethereum) open interest was approximately **$84.38 billion**.

Short liquidations dominated. Bitcoin recorded $32.85 million in short liquidations versus $15.73 million in longs. Ethereum recorded $65.58 million in short liquidations versus $21.68 million in longs.

Combined liquidations totaled **$135.84 million**, with **$98.43 million**, or approximately 72.4%, coming from shorts. Ethereum saw the larger total, including a reported **$62.58 million** liquidation event at 20:00 UTC on September 14.

The data points to a short squeeze and position reduction rather than a new leverage-driven rally. Bitcoin rose during the broader derivatives measurement period while open interest fell 1.64%. Funding remained positive but well below the 0.03% per-eight-hour level associated with crowded long positioning.
